description

The Council would like to procure a consultant or consultancy to undertake a climate change risk and impact assessment and produces recommendations for Kent as part of the EU funded Flood Resilient Areas by Multi-LayEred Safety (FRAMES) Project. The work will include research, data analysis, stakeholder engagement and report writing services and will result in the production of a detailed assessment of the county's current and future risks, opportunities and impacts of climate change; reliable economic valuations where possible; recommendations for Local Government and well-founded considerations of the impacts to specific sectors (including Health and Social Care, Transport, Utilities, Natural Environment and Agriculture) integrating findings from the CCRA 2017 and the GIF 2018.
